{
  "schema_version": 1,
  "generated_at": "2026-05-20T10:38:59Z",
  "ticker": "RIOT",
  "headline": "RIOT: no edge \u2014 z=+0.55, trading near 20-day mean",
  "body": "RIOT is trading near its 20-day mean (z=+0.55, trading near 20-day mean), so the mean-reversion strategy has no edge here. Insider read: 1 insider sale(s), no offsetting buys. No catalyst tags surfaced in today's news scan. Hold hands.",
  "confidence": 0.0,
  "signal_type": "wait",
  "bullet_points": [
    "Last close: $22.65 (-2.31% today)",
    "20-day mean: $20.81 \u2014 z=+0.55, trading near 20-day mean",
    "Insiders (30d): 1 insider sale(s), no offsetting buys",
    "Recent news: 3 headlines, latest 7.2h ago \u2014 \"CleanSpark (CLSK) Climbs 9.3% as Analyst \u2018Highly Optimistic\u2019\""
  ]
}